Product Overview

The CC-PAIL51 (CCPAIL51) stands as a high-performance temperature sensing solution within the Honeywell Experion Series-C Mark II I/O family. Specifically engineered for mission-critical thermal monitoring in industries such as hydrocarbon processing and power generation, this Low Level Analog Input (LLAI) module provides high-density support for 16 RTD and Thermocouple (TC) circuits. The module’s core value lies in its high-integrity data qualification; it features a fixed 1-second PV scanning rate coupled with advanced Open Thermocouple Detection (OTD) protection. By automatically setting Process Variables to "Not a Number" (NAN) upon sensor failure, the CC-PAIL51 prevents erratic control loop responses, effectively reducing plant risk and minimizing expensive unscheduled maintenance caused by instrument degradation.

Technical Configuration

The CC-PAIL51 hardware is optimized for signal stability and thermal management within high-density cabinet environments.

  • Comprehensive Sensor Library: Native linearization for a broad spectrum of sensors, including Platinum (100 ohm), Nickel (120 ohm), and Copper (10/50 ohm) RTDs, as well as ANSI Type J, K, E, T, B, S, and R thermocouples
  • Total Galvanic Isolation: Provides robust 16-channel isolation, including channel-to-channel, channel-to-DCS backplane, and channel-to-power common, shielding sensitive measurements from ground loop interference.
  • Diagnostic Precision: The 1-second update cycle includes a mandatory OTD check before PV propagation. If sensor resistance exceeds 1500 ohms, the system triggers a guaranteed trip to protect control integrity
  • Series-C Mark II Innovation: Utilizes the "tilted" module design for superior heat dissipation and features a vertical mounting profile to streamline high-density field wiring entry.

Technical Specifications

Feature Specification
Model CC-PAIL51
Brand Honeywell Experion Series-C
I/O Type Low Level Analog (Temperature) Input
Input Channels 16 (Fully Isolated)
Scan Rate 1 second (Fixed)
IOTA Compatibility DC-TAIL51 (Non-Redundant 9-inch)
Nominal Input Range -20 to +100 mV (TC only)
Gain Error 0.050% Full Scale Maximum
Temperature Stability +/- 20 ppm per deg C Maximum
CMRR (50/60 Hz) 120 dB Minimum
RTD Excitation 1 milliamp
Operating Temp 0 to 60 deg C (Standard Series-C)

Technical FAQs

How does the CC-PAIL51 prevent "false" control actions during a sensor break? 

The module utilizes a "sample and hold" OTD cycle. If an open sensor is detected, the Process Variable is set to NAN (Not a Number) and a soft failure is reported. This ensures no invalid data is propagated to the controller, preventing inappropriate PID responses.

What are the specific IOTA options for this module? 

The CC-PAIL51 typically resides on the DC-TAIL51 IOTA, which is a 9-inch (228 mm) assembly for non-redundant applications.

Does the module support millivolt-only inputs without linearization? 

Yes, the module supports standard millivolt types ranging from -20 to +100 millivolts, allowing it to interface with specialized non-standard sensing devices.


Engineering & Installation Guide

  • Cold Junction Compensation (CJC): All thermocouple inputs are automatically compensated using a CJC device located on the IOTA. To ensure accuracy, avoid installing the IOTA near high-heat components that could create localized thermal gradients across the termination assembly. 
  • RTD Wiring Integrity: For RTD sensors, lead resistance must be strictly managed (maximum 15 ohms). Use high-quality shielded 3-wire or 4-wire cabling to maintain the 120 dB Common Mode Rejection Ratio (CMRR) and prevent noise from distorting low-level temperature signals
  • Surge Protection: The module features integrated surge protection per EN 61000-4-5 (1 kV line-to-line, 2 kV line-to-ground). For outdoor sensor runs or environments with high lightning risk, external primary surge arrestors are still recommended to protect the IOTA electronics.
